История компьютерной графики – это увлекательный путь, который охватывает более полувека инноваций и технологических прорывов. С момента появления первых вычислительных машин до современных реалистичных 3D-изображений, компьютерная графика прошла долгий путь, и каждый этап этого развития оставил свой след в различных областях, таких как искусство, наука, развлечения и образование.
Первые шаги в области компьютерной графики были сделаны в 1960-х годах, когда учёные начали использовать компьютеры для создания простейших визуализаций. Одним из первых примеров является работа Стива Рассела в MIT, который создал игру «Spacewar!» в 1962 году. Эта игра использовала графику для отображения двух космических кораблей, что стало основой для дальнейших исследований и разработок в области графики. В это время графика была ограничена простыми линиями и точками, так как вычислительные мощности были весьма ограничены.
В 1970-х годах началась эволюция компьютерной графики с появлением векторной графики. Векторные изображения создаются с помощью математических формул, что позволяет достигать высокой степени детализации и масштабируемости без потери качества. В это время разработаны первые графические редакторы, такие как Sketchpad, созданный Иваном Сазерлендом, который позволил пользователям рисовать на экране с помощью графического планшета. Это стало важным шагом в развитии графических интерфейсов и положило начало современным графическим программам.
С конца 1970-х до начала 1980-х годов компьютерная графика продолжала развиваться благодаря появлению растровой графики. Растровая графика основана на пикселях, что позволяет создавать более сложные изображения, но требует больше ресурсов для хранения и обработки. В это время также началось активное использование графики в киноиндустрии. Фильм «Звёздные войны» (1977) стал одним из первых фильмов, в котором использовались визуальные эффекты, созданные с помощью компьютерной графики. Это привело к тому, что графика стала неотъемлемой частью кино и анимации.
В 1990-х годах произошёл настоящий прорыв в области трёхмерной графики. Появление мощных графических процессоров (GPU) и новых алгоритмов, таких как текстурирование и освещение, позволило создавать фотореалистичные изображения. Игры, такие как Doom и Quake, продемонстрировали возможности 3D-графики и стали основоположниками жанра шутеров от первого лица. В это время также начали активно развиваться программы для 3D-моделирования, такие как 3ds Max и Maya, которые стали стандартом в индустрии.
С начала 2000-х годов компьютерная графика претерпела значительные изменения благодаря развитию технологий рендеринга и анимации. Появление Real-Time Rendering позволило создавать интерактивные 3D-изображения в реальном времени, что стало важным для видеоигр и виртуальной реальности. В это время также началась активная работа над графическими движками, такими как Unreal Engine и Unity, которые сделали создание игр более доступным для разработчиков и художников.
Современная компьютерная графика активно использует технологии искусственного интеллекта и машинного обучения. Это позволяет создавать ещё более реалистичные изображения и анимации, а также автоматизировать процесс создания контента. Виртуальная и дополненная реальность стали новыми направлениями, где компьютерная графика играет ключевую роль. Разработчики создают immersive experiences, которые позволяют пользователям взаимодействовать с виртуальными мирами, что открывает новые горизонты для образования, развлечений и бизнеса.
Таким образом, история компьютерной графики – это история постоянного поиска новых решений и технологий, которые позволяют создавать всё более сложные и реалистичные визуализации. От простых линий и точек до фотореалистичных 3D-изображений и виртуальной реальности – каждый этап развития графики стал важным вкладом в науку и искусство. Компьютерная графика продолжает эволюционировать, и можно с уверенностью сказать, что впереди нас ждёт ещё множество удивительных открытий и инноваций.